Front Panel and Web App
These settings tell the Controller how to determine when a cook is
done and what to do afterward.
There are three ways to cook with the Muxall Pro BBQ Controller:
HOT DOG EASY
– Basically, turn the grill on, set a temp and start
cooking. The grill will stay at the set temp forever.
COOK BY TIME
– Enter Target Temps and Cook Times in any or all of
the four profiles (1-4)
without
Hold checked
in any of the four
profiles. The grill will start from Profile 1 and go to Profile 4 following
the temps and times set. When it gets to the end of Profile 4, the
cook is done.
COOK-BY-PROBE
– The same as Cook-By-Time except Hold is
checked in the last profile you intend to use. When the meat
reaches the Target Probe Temp, the cook is done.
